Output 660336845d2092b7c9929be3f8065aee8dba8e1a35bb254e8f1eb5692ee94ec7:64

value
5523
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5efdc8298398152a29c7800a345f2f485e138c559e6106d4f843b212ee8f6a73
address
bc1ptm7us2vrnq2j52w8sq9rghe0fp0p8rz4nessd48cgwep9m50dfes99gmv0
transaction
660336845d2092b7c9929be3f8065aee8dba8e1a35bb254e8f1eb5692ee94ec7
spent
true